Trying to get into the craft beer industry. I have a bs in finance. Would like to do possible marketing or work in the actual brewery. Want to learn the business and help the company kick ass. Hopes to one day open my own brewery.
Any suggestions?
Thanks
 
Really, the best thing would be to contact breweries directly. There's so much competition for this kind of work, they don't really need to advertise it. Larger breweries will have job openings on the website, others you may have to find the contact info of some higher ups and talk to them directly. Ultimately, though, you should consider work that will help you on your goal to owning a brewery, not so much finance and marketing work. It's cool to work at a brewery, but doing financials at a brewery will be 99.995% the same as doing financials at a sheet metal manufacturer.
